Medical errors or negligence: two babies died in Mukachevo

Two young patients, aged 5 and 8 months, died at the Transcarpathian Regional Children's Hospital. The first case occurred in December 2024, the second on January 24, 2026. Law enforcement officers opened criminal proceedings in both cases and declared the obstetrician-gynecologist of the medical institution suspicious.

According to the parents of a 5-month-old boy, the child was born prematurely with bronchopulmonary dysplasia, but after treatment his condition improved significantly. On January 23, 2026, the parents went to the doctors because of the child's cough and stayed overnight in the hospital for observation. According to the family, during the administration of the drug through the infusion machine, the medical worker abruptly injected the fluid manually, which caused a sharp deterioration in the child's condition. Access to the intensive care unit was complicated by the closed door, and the parents assess the subsequent actions of the staff as insufficiently prompt. Doctors reported that the cause of death was pulmonary and cerebral edema.

The Transcarpathian regional police have opened criminal proceedings under Part 2 of Article 140 of the Criminal Code of Ukraine (improper performance of professional duties by a medical professional, which resulted in grave consequences), which provides for up to 3 years of imprisonment.

Representatives of the Transcarpathian Regional Children's Hospital stated that all actions of the staff were carried out in accordance with clinical protocols, and the child's condition progressively deteriorated, despite the assistance provided. The medical institution expressed condolences to the family and promised that further actions will be taken within the framework of the law.

The second case concerns the death of an infant who suffered severe birth injuries to the cervical spine and spinal cord during birth in March 2024. The boy died in December of the same year. The results of a medical examination determined that the death was caused by the unprofessional actions of an obstetrician-gynecologist.

In both cases, suspicion was declared against one obstetrician-gynecologist for improper performance of professional duties, which led to serious consequences (Part 2 of Article 140 of the Criminal Code of Ukraine).

The Transcarpathian Regional Children's Hospital is located in Mukachevo and is a municipal non-profit enterprise of the regional council. Since 2025, the director of the institution has been Volodymyr Beiresh.
